Front
What is factoring in mathematics?
Back
Factoring is the process of breaking down an expression into a product of simpler factors that, when multiplied together, give the original expression.

Front
What is a trinomial?
Back
A trinomial is a polynomial that consists of three terms, typically in the form ax^2 + bx + c.

Front
How do you factor the trinomial x^2 + 5x + 6?
Back
The factors are (x + 2)(x + 3).

Front
What is the greatest common factor (GCF)?
Back
The GCF is the largest positive integer that divides all the numbers in a set without leaving a remainder.
